Whitecaps closer to new home - The Delta Optimist

After months of negotiations, Delta has moved a step closer to having a world-class soccer training facility at John Oliver Park. the municipality has signed a memorandum of understanding with the Vancouver Whitecaps for the soccer club to construct a training centre with playing fields and other park improvements. It has a price tag of approximately $25 million.
